We honor the courage, sacrifice, and enduring spirit of the ANZACs- those brace men and women who served, and continue to serve, our country in times of war, conflict, and peacekeeping.
ANZAC Day is not just a commemoration of a single moment in history - it reflects the values that define us; mate ship; resilience, courage, and service above self. These are the same values we hold dear in Rotary, and the same values we strive to uphold in our service to the community and the world.
Form the shore of Gallipoli to the fields of Europe, from the jungles of Southeast Asia to the deserts of the Middle East, Australian and New Zealand soldiers have stood for freedom, justice, and peace. their legacy lives on - not only in memories and ceremonies - but in every act of kindness, in every hand extended to help, and in every step we take toward building a better world.
Let us remember the fallen, honor the returned, and support those still serving. Let us teach the next generation the meaning of remberberence - not just in words, but in action.
As we pause to reflect, we say with gratitude and reverence:
Lest we forget
